​R.A.D. Graded Examinations Class

R.A.D. Graded Examinations Class with the Royal Academy of Dance (RAD) provides structured ballet training from Pre-Primary through Grade 8, focusing on progressive technique, musicality, and performance, with exams assessed by an RAD examiner for globally recognized certification, often requiring dedicated classes and building towards professional ballet careers. 

What It Is

  • Structured Curriculum: A systematic approach to classical ballet from foundational steps to advanced skills.

  • International Recognition: RAD qualifications are respected worldwide, often used as benchmarks for vocational training.

  • Progressive Levels: From Pre-Primary (younger children) to Grade 8, with increasing technical demands. 

Types of Assessments

  • Graded Exams: Students perform a set syllabus in a group (max 4) for an examiner, with the teacher usually absent, focusing on technique, musicality, and performance.

  • Class Awards: A teacher-led class where students perform for an examiner to demonstrate progress, for those not ready for full exams or attending less frequently.
